摘要 <p>PURPOSE:To enable the production of the artificial joint which meets different sizes in a short period of time, has the high fitness to the residual bone and prevents the induction of a bone fracture by integrally forming a core part between an engaging part and a stem part and forming a sheath part to a separate body of a blank material which is lighter in weight than the core part and has a small Young's modulus. CONSTITUTION:The prosthetic part formed between the stem part 23 and the joint engaging part 21 consists of the core part 22b and the sheath part 22a. The core part 22b is made of a metal and is integrally formed of the stem part 23 and the engaging part 21. The sheath part 22a is formed of a high- polymer material, such as high-density polyethylene or polycarbonate resin, a light metallic material, such as pure titanium or titanium alloy, or rubber material, etc. This part is formed of the material which is lighter in weight than the core part 22b and has the small Young's modulus. As a result, the artificial joint member 2 is formed lighter than the conventional artificial joints and has the Young's modulus approximate to the Young's modulus of the residual bone. The member does not hinder walking and does not lead to the bone fracture.</p>
